How much does a bathroom renovation cost in Ottawa?
Bathroom renovation costs in Ottawa typically range from $8,000-$12,000 for a cosmetic refresh (new fixtures, tile, vanity), $15,000-$25,000 for a full 3-piece renovation with layout changes, and $30,000-$55,000+ for a luxury ensuite. Factors include bathroom size, fixture grades, whether plumbing is moved, and material choices. We provide detailed, fixed-price quotes after a free in-home assessment, so you know exactly what you’ll pay before work begins.
Do I need a permit for a bathroom renovation in Ottawa?
It depends on the scope of work. Cosmetic changes (new paint, fixtures, vanity) generally do not require a permit. However, if your project involves moving plumbing, adding a bathroom, or structural changes, a building permit from the City of Ottawa is required. On Point Renovations handles all permit applications on your behalf as part of our project management process.
What is included in a full bathroom renovation?
A full bathroom renovation typically includes: demolition and waste removal, rough plumbing and drain reconfiguration if needed, waterproofing and cement board installation, tile installation on floors and walls, new vanity and countertop, toilet replacement, shower or tub installation, lighting and exhaust fan, trim and door hardware, and final paint. We manage all trades under one contract, so you have a single point of accountability.
Can you renovate a bathroom in a condo in Ottawa?
Yes. We have extensive experience with condo bathroom renovations across Ottawa, including buildings in Centretown, Little Italy, Westboro, and Barrhaven. Condo renovations require additional steps: written approval from the condo corporation, noise/work hour compliance, freight elevator bookings, and protection of common areas. We handle all of this coordination on your behalf, and we carry the insurance required by most Ottawa condo boards.

What is the difference between a bathroom renovation and a bathroom remodel?
The terms are often used interchangeably. Technically, a renovation refers to restoring or updating what is already there (new tile, new fixtures, new vanity), while a remodel involves changing the layout or structure (moving walls, relocating plumbing). At On Point Renovations, we handle both, from simple refreshes to full bathroom remodels in Ottawa that change the floor plan entirely.
